Special issue published: "Application of Lean Six Sigma Methods for Process Excellence in Indian Industries"

International Journal of Six Sigma and Competitive Advantage 13(1/2/3) 2021

  • Lean Six Sigma imperatives for casting quality improvement of automotive components: a case
  • Integration between Lean, Six Sigma and Industry 4.0 technologies
  • Improvement in performance measures by desirability coupled with Lean Six Sigma tool on titanium matrix composite: a novel approach
  • Grey relational analysis of Green Lean Six Sigma critical success factors for improved organisational performance
  • Lean Six Sigma implementation in an Indian manufacturing organisation: a case study
  • Green Lean Six Sigma critical barriers: exploration and investigation for improved sustainable performance
  • Integration of Six Sigma and lean for superior sustainability of dairy production
  • Analysis of interactions among lean barriers in new product development
  • Implementing lean through value stream mapping for productivity improvement: a case study of link frame mechanical press manufacturing industry
  • Reducing the cost of poor quality and improving process output by adopting a Six Sigma DMAIC tool: a case study
  • A framework for achieving lean orientation in complex production value streams
  • Implementation of a Six Sigma strategy for process improvement in the wiper motor manufacturing industry
  • Cost of poor quality reduction in auto sector: an exploration with Six-Sigma
  • An optimised framework for the implementation of hybrid lean and agile manufacturing systems in the rolling industry for India
  • Enhancing the capability of a PVC pipe extrusion process through the Six Sigma's strategic approach
  • Unearthing the determinants of total quality management on employees' satisfaction of Delhi Metro Rail Corporation
  • Optimisation of choice of hospitals based on Lean Six Sigma implementation indicators - customer viewpoint
  • A comprehensive method for modelling leanness enablers and measuring leanness index in MSMEs using an integrated AHP-ISM-MICMAC and multi-grade fuzzy approach
